Crash involving school bus leaves woman seriously injured
A New Jersey woman was seriously injured in a crash that sent a school bus into a ditch in Geneva, Ontario County, on Monday afternoon, according to the Ontario County Sheriff's Office. The crash occurred just before 3:30 p.m. on County Road 6 and Billsboro Road. Wells College to close after 156 years, citing financial strain

Work begins on rehabilitating roadways in the Finger Lakes region
ROCHESTER, N.Y. (WROC) — Work is underway on a series of projects across Monroe County and surrounding areas to improve road conditions.
